HEADLAMP SERVICEABILITY

Models:
'01 RX3OO

Introduction
To improve serviceability on the 2001 RX 300, the headlamp protector retainers have been established as separate service parts. If a headlamp retainer is damaged, the headlamp can be reused by installing the appropriate retainer. Please use the procedures described in this bulletin to repair the affected headlamp retainer.

Applicable Vehicles

^ 2001 model year RX 300 vehicles

Repair Procedure

HEADLAMP REMOVAL

1. Remove Lower Grill.

A. Remove the 7 screws





B. Disconnect the 6 retainers and remove the lower grill.

2. Remove Front Fender Liner.

3. Remove Headlamp.

A. Disconnect the connectors.





B. Remove the bolt and 2 nuts.

C. Pull the headlamp forward to remove it, then disconnect the bracket that attaches the headlamp to the vehicle body.





4. Install Headlamp.





A. If the sections highlighted in the illustrations are damaged, cut the shaded portion off flush with the housing base (as seen in the illustrations).

B. Sand the cut portion as necessary.





C. Install the replacement retainers to the boss of the headlamp with screws.

D. Install the headlamp.

E. Install the headlamp with the bolt and 2 nuts.

F. Reconnect the connectors.

5. Install Front Fender Liner.

6. Install Lower Grill.
